ASP.NET 2.0电子商务开发实战指南

需积分: 0 4 下载量 68 浏览量 更新于2024-07-31 收藏 20.79MB PDF 举报
"本书是《asp.net.2.0电子商务开发实战》,由Cristian Darie和Karli Watson合著,旨在帮助初学者到专业人士掌握使用ASP.NET 2.0进行电子商务网站开发的技能。书中深入探讨了使用C#语言构建电子商务平台的各种技术和策略。" 在ASP.NET 2.0这个强大的Web应用程序框架中,开发者可以利用其丰富的功能来创建高效、安全且可扩展的电子商务解决方案。本书详细介绍了以下关键知识点: 1. **ASP.NET基础**:首先,书中的内容会引导读者了解ASP.NET 2.0的基础,包括控件、事件模型、页面生命周期和状态管理,这些都是构建任何Web应用的基础。 2. **C#编程**:由于本书是用C#语言编写的,因此它将深入讲解C#的关键特性,如面向对象编程、异常处理、泛型以及.NET Framework库的使用。 3. **数据库集成**:在电子商务中,数据存储和检索至关重要。书中会涵盖如何使用ADO.NET与SQL Server进行交互,创建数据访问层,以及使用Entity Framework等ORM工具。 4. **安全性**:电子商务网站需要强大的安全机制。本书会讨论身份验证、授权、加密和解密、防止SQL注入和跨站脚本攻击(XSS)等安全实践。 5. **购物车和订单处理**:电子商务的核心部分是购物车和订单系统。作者会解释如何实现购物车功能,处理支付网关集成,以及订单的创建、确认和跟踪。 6. **用户界面和用户体验**:书中会涉及使用ASP.NET控件创建响应式和用户友好的界面,以及优化网站性能和可用性。 7. **支付集成**:电子商务通常涉及到与第三方支付服务提供商的接口,如PayPal或Stripe。作者可能会介绍如何安全地集成这些服务。 8. **物流和库存管理**:电子商务系统的后端管理功能,如库存控制、物流跟踪,也会被讨论。 9. **测试和调试**:有效的测试和调试策略对于确保电子商务网站的稳定性和可靠性至关重要。书中有专门的章节介绍单元测试、集成测试和性能测试。 10. **部署和维护**:最后,书中还会涵盖如何将应用程序部署到生产环境,以及如何进行持续集成和持续部署(CI/CD),以确保网站的稳定运行和更新。 《asp.net.2.0电子商务开发实战》是一本全面的指南,涵盖了从设计、开发到部署和维护电子商务网站的整个过程。通过学习本书,读者将能够利用ASP.NET 2.0和C#的强大功能,构建出符合现代标准的电子商务平台。